NOVENA – FIRST NIGHT

RIDERS CAME FROM ALL OVER THE PLACE
The first major event organized by the Peña Caballista ‘El Estribo’ was an enormous success, contributing to make this charming little feria even more so. There were riders from everywhere and lots of onlookers. Other things went on, too, like the coronation of the Queen of the Fair, who arrived on scene with her Ladies-in-Waiting aboard a colourful float. The kids had a great time on the rides and everyone went home late, but happy.

FIESTA DE LA NOVENA, ESTACIÓN

The annual Novena, as it’s called, begins tonight at 7.30 with the coronation of the young Reina, plus several other activities that you can read about in the official programme (below) if you can find one.

Among other things, the Peña Caballista El Estribo is holding a competition (8.30) for the best-dressed rider and will then be parading through the streets of Estación. And there’s music and dancing at their Novena headquarters, and probably everywhere else as well. Then there’s a donkey race tomorrow, Saturday, at 8.30 pm… (You can see El Estribo’s programme here). There are also culinary competitions, children’s rides, stalls of all kinds and the 26th Jimena Flamenco Festival tomorrow, Friday 31st, at 10.30 pm.
This is one of Jimena’s most popular festivities that culminates on Sunday with a procession of the Patron Saint, Nuestra Señora de los Ángeles (Our Lady of the Angels) on Sunday evening.

The essence of a Domingo Rociero is to meet up with friends you may not have seen for a while – or just a moment ago. Conversation and good cheer is what it’s about on a sun day at the feria.
